Simon Conway Morris, University of Cambridge, United Kingdom
Why Evolution is Predictable: Journeys of a Palaeontologist
Darwin understood the central importance of the fossil record to his theory of evolution, and since then the many extraordinary finds have dramatically confirmed the genius of his insights. Nevertheless, whilst the reality of evolution is not in dispute problems remain. Darwin himself was very puzzled by the event now known as the Cambrian "explosion" and it is notable that in The Origin this is the one area where, in terms of explanation, he is almost entirely at sea. We know much more about the Cambrian "explosion", but a general explanation is still needed. Perhaps we need to take a wider view as to how Earth-like planets may evolve in a biogeochemical context. But the Cambrian "explosion" is also of central importance because it marks the emergence of complex nervous and sensory systems, and ultimately brains and intelligence. It is received wisdom in nearly all neo-Darwinian circles that these, like any other evolutionary end-point, are effectively flukes, mere accidents of history. Such resonates, of course, with the emphasis on randomness, be it in terms of mutation or mass extinctions. Stephen Jay Gould observed, using the famous Burgess Shale as his exemplar, that were we to re-run the tape of life then the end-products would be completely different. No humans, for example. Drawing on evolutionary convergence I will argue for the complete opposite, and in doing so will suggest that evolution is like any other science, that is predictable.
